Essential Duties and Responsibilities: 

  • Review the hospital census or utilize established referral method to identify self-pay patients consistently throughout the day. 

  • Screen those patients that are referred to Firstsource for State, County and/or Federal eligibility assistance programs. 

  • Initiate the application process bedside when possible. 

  • Identifies specific patient needs and assist them with an enrollment application to the appropriate agency for assistance. 

  • Introduces the patients to Firstsource services and informs them that we will be contacting them on a regular basis about their progress. 

  • Provides transition, as applicable, for the backend Patient Advocate Specialist to develop a positive relationship with the patient. 

  • Records all patient information on the designated in-house screening sheet. 

  • Document the results of the screening in the onsite tracking tool and hospital computer system. 

  • Identifies out-patient/ER accounts from the census or applicable referral method that are designated as self-pay. 

  • Reviews system for available information for each outpatient account identified as self-pay. 

  • Face to face screen patients on site as able.  Attempts to reach patient by telephone if unable to screen face to face.  

  • Document out-patient/ER accounts when accepted in the hospital system and on-site tracking tool. 

  • Outside field work as required to include Patient home visits to screen for eligibility of State, County, and Federal programs. 

  • Other Duties as assigned or required by client contract
